Pizza Bombs
8 servings
servings10 minutes
active time32 minutes
total timeIngredients
1 can (8-count) Southern Homestyle buttermilk biscuits, (not flaky)
1 cup (257 g) pizza sauce, (divided)
½ cup (69 g) mini pepperoni slices, (divided)
4 ounces mozzarella cheese, (cut into 16 equal-sized cubes, divided)
¼ cup (½ stick / 57 g) unsalted butter, (melted)
¼ teaspoon garlic salt
¼ teaspoon Italian seasoning
2 tablespoons parmesan cheese, (grated)
Directions
Pizza Bombs
Preheat oven. Spray oven-safe skillet with nonstick cooking spray.
Preheat the oven to 375°F and spray a 12-inch, oven-safe skillet with nonstick spray. (You could also use a greased baking dish, but the cooking time may vary.)
Flatten each biscuit.
Remove the biscuits from the can and place them on a clean work surface. Using a rolling pin, flatten each biscuit to about ⅛-inch thickness.
Top each biscuit with sauce, pepperoni, and cheese.
Top each biscuit with 1 tablespoon of pizza sauce, 1 tablespoon pepperoni slices, and 2 cubes of mozzarella cheese.
Roll ingredients into biscuits.
Fold the edges of the biscuit together, pinching them tightly so there are no holes or gaps. Place the bomb seam side down into the prepared skillet. Repeat with the remaining bombs.
Bake for 20-22 minutes, or until the biscuits are golden brown.
Garlic Butter
Make garlic butter.
In a small bowl, mix together the melted butter, garlic salt, Italian seasoning, and parmesan cheese.
Brush garlic butter over the tops.
After removing the pizza bombs from the oven, brush the garlic butter mixture over the top.
Serve warm with pizza sauce.
Serve with the remaining pizza sauce for dipping. Enjoy!
